The Climates of
Spain
Mediterranean Climate (Typical)
• Located in:
– Balearic Islands
– South and east of the peninsula
– In some inland areas
• Precipitations:
– Little rainfall (300-800 mm)
• Temperatures:
– Small annual range of temperatures (from 10º to 15º)
– Hot summers and
– Mild winters
Mediterranean Continental
• Location:
– Inland areas
• Precipitation:
– Very little precipitation (300-600 mm)
• Temperatures:
– High annual range of temperatures (more than15º)
– Summers: very hot
– Winters: very cold
Oceanic Climate
• Location:
– North and north-west of the Peninsula.
• Precipitations:
– Abundant and continuous precipitations (it rains
throughout the year).
– More than 800 mm per year
• Temperatures:
– Small annual range of temperatures (less than
15º)
– Winters are mild
– Summers are cool
Subtropical Climate
• Location:
– Canary Islands
• Precipitations:
– Low lands: very little precipitations (from 150 mm
to 300 mm per year)
– High lands: Abundant precipitations (> 1000 mm)
• Temperatures:
– Small annual range of temperatures (less than 8º)
– Hot temperatures all the year
Other Climates:
• Mountain Climate:
– Located in High lands (more than 1000 m. of
height)
• Desert Climate:
– It rains very little (less than 300mm).
– Located:
• Almería
• Inland south-east (La Mancha, Albacete)
• Middle area of Ebro valley (Zaragoza - Teruel):
Monegros Desert
